What are the differences among Bissell Little Green, the Proheat, and the Spot clean Proheat?

All the products we’ve included in our comparison are top-notch carpet cleaners. What this means is that the vast majority of buyers should be happy with any of the available options. But there are several important distinctions to remember before making a final choice.

For the record, Bissell Little Green Proheat isn’t manufactured any longer and, as a result, may be challenging to locate. The latest Bissel Spot clean Proheat has taken over for this model.

Bissell little green vs Little green proheat

Bissell Little Green vs Proheat | https://spotlesschoice.com | 2023

To begin, it’s important to note that the Bissell Little Green was the first model in this line. This carpet cleaner was the first one on the market. It was thought of and made before its competitors were even born. In light of this, it’s clear that this carpet cleaner isn’t the most cutting-edge or effective model available.

This device has a standard motor with a rating of 3 amps. To provide enough suction, it must be more powerful than competing models. Like those used by Little Green’s modern competitors, motors with a higher amp rating mean more suction power and a deeper clean for your carpets.

Heatwave technology softens dirt by heating the water, but Little Green lacks it. This technology does not heat cold tap water; it is kept at a comfortable temperature while being used in the washing process.

Heatwave technology is built into the Bissell Proheat and the Bissell Spotclean Proheat. Some people might need help telling the difference between the Bissell Little Green and the Bissell Little Green Proheat because of their similar designs. The number of buttons on the casing is one subtle change in design.

Compared to the Proheat version, the original Little Green only has one button. The advanced model features an additional heating switch and the normal on/off control.

Some features of the Bissell Spotclean Proheat are only available on that model and not on the other two. It’s an upgraded model of the previously unavailable Bissell Spotclean 5207N.

One of the most obvious differences between this model and the regular one is the size of the tank. This model has a 37-ounce tank, while the regular one has a 48-ounce tank. The shape of the hose has been tweaked somewhat, and a new Hydrorinse self-cleaning hose tool has been included.

The general design has also been overhauled. However, this is largely a cosmetic alteration. It has industry-standard heatwave technology that helps to keep the water hot while you’re washing.

Bissell Little Green

Bissell Little Green vs Proheat | https://spotlesschoice.com | 2023

As we mentioned before, the first model in the Bissell line was the Bissell Little Green. It follows that it lacks the cutting-edge features of the other two versions. Even though some other cleaners may do the same things, this one is much cheaper.

All you need to get started with your Little Green is the case, two water tanks, and the hose that attaches to the back of the case. A little carry handle is integrated into the top of the case for easy transport.

If this is your first time buying a carpet cleaner, you couldn’t have picked a better option. A 3 amp motor should be sufficient for regular cleaning and spot removal. However, if you require a more robust cleaner, we advise going with either of the other two options.

The tank can be taken off without tools so that it can be filled or emptied easily. It also comes with a plug that won’t leak. To get the best results when cleaning, the tank is marked to show the right amount of water to the cleaning solution.

This carpet cleaner is easy to use and light, so you can use it on surfaces other than carpeting. T his carpet cleaner is easy to use and light, so you can use it on surfaces other than carpeting. According to the company that makes it, it can be used to clean a wide range of surfaces, such as carpets, furniture, stairs, area rugs, car interiors, and more.

To pre-soak a carpet in cleaning solution, press the handle’s spray trigger. Following this method, washing your home should be a breeze.

Little Green Proheat

Bissell Little Green vs Proheat | https://spotlesschoice.com | 2023

The Bissell Little Green Proheat is a big step up from the original Little Green. It’s an excellent carpet cleaner that doesn’t have a single problem in its operation.

Unlike its predecessor, this carpet cleaner has Heatwave Technology. This alone is a huge time saver while cleaning because hot water stays in the tank for much longer. Particularly helpful for those with a lot of carpet or a large space to clean.

This carpet cleaner looks and functions similarly to the classic Little Green. The main housing, two water tanks, and a hose that attaches to the rear of the accommodation make up its constituent parts. A convenient carry handle on the top of the case makes the product much easier to take.

An extra button on the case controls the heat. There is only one button on a regular Little Green, and it turns the device on and off. It helps set apart the two goods despite their nearly identical design.

This product has a respectable tank capacity of 48 ounces. The tank has markings for both water and formula levels, much like a regular Little Green. When either tank needs to be removed, a specific plug is used to seal off the connection.

The ergonomically designed grip doubles as the spray area’s dedicated button. With this, the dirt can be soaked up and worked loose before cleaning, ensuring the carpet is clean and free of particles.

In addition, the 9 amp motor gives this gadget superior suction. Even the deepest entrenched stains in your carpet will not match this machine. Cleaning carpets, upholstery, stairs, area rugs, or the inside of a car won’t be a chore because of the unit’s portability.

Even so, keep in mind that, like the other two models we’re comparing, this one requires an outlet nearby, and this necessitates that you remain near a source of electrical power at all times.

Bissell Spotclean 2694 ProHeat Spot Cleaner

Bissell Little Green vs Proheat | https://spotlesschoice.com | 2023

Lastly, we have the Bissell Spotclean Proheat 2694 carpet cleaner. Additionally, of those three items, it represents the most current revision. This model is an updated version of the Bissell Spotclean 5207N, which is part of a line meant to replace the Bissell Little Green Proheat.

In the same vein as the Proheat version, this is a really effective carpet cleaner that pleases even the pickiest of buyers. Its 9-amp motor provides significantly stronger suction than those of conventional carpet cleaners. Even the most entrenched stains ought to be easily eradicated in this manner.

The Hydrorinse self-cleaning hose tool and a slight modification to the hose design set this model apart. In addition, it can only hold 37 ounces of liquid before it overflows. Also, this tank has special markings that show where the right amount of water and formula should be. This new carpet cleaner also features a novel design.

Although many features remain in the same places, the carpet cleaner now has a very modern appearance. It contains two water tanks, a cleaning hose, and its slimmer case. As an added convenience, a carry handle has been integrated into the top of the case.

The water can stay comfortably warm thanks to Heatwave Technology’s innovative design. Cleaning is accelerated and efficiency is increased thanks to the use of hot water. This unit’s many specialized features make it perfect for cleaning a wide range of surfaces, such as carpets, upholstered furniture, stairwells, area rugs, car interiors, and more.

Like the other two types, this one has a specialized spray trigger for eradicating even the most entrenched stains. Simply spray the affected area with the cleaner and let it sit for a while before cleaning.

Conclusion

Last but not least, all three versions are trustworthy cleaners that should meet the needs of the vast majority of buyers. But there are several important distinctions to remember before making a final choice.

For those who have never cleaned a carpet before, the Bissell Little Green is an excellent option because of its low price and adequate performance. Compared to the other cleaners we tested, the biggest problems with this one are its 3 amp motor and less suction. Nevertheless, it ought to be adequate for most uses.

Bissell’s Little Green Proheat is the superior model because of its stronger suction and Heatwave technology, which keeps the water at a comfortable temperature while you clean. It’s ideal for anyone using a cleaner with a bit extra oomph. There is, however, one catch: this gadget is no longer manufactured, so it can be challenging to track down.

The Bissell Spotclean Proheat 2694 is the last choice. It is an updated version of the Bissell Spotclean 5207N. The line is an alternative to the Bissell Little Green Proheat. This new carpet cleaner is a different shape and size than its predecessors. As with the other two models, it has a spray trigger on the hose, Heatwave Technology, and a self-cleaning hose tool.

Based on the differences above, we recommend the Bissell Spotclean Proheat 2694 because it is easy to find (unlike the Proheat version), works well, is portable, and is well-made. The price has stayed at a reasonable level as well.
